The Guest by Emma Cline

3.0

I can’t say I really enjoyed The Guest, but it definitely did capture my attention - I read it super quickly because I was very curious about how things would shake out for our problematic protagonist, Alex. 

I love stories about slightly unhinged women making questionable choices, but ultimately there are just better books than this one if you’re trying to scratch that itch. While a lot of things happen throughout the story, I never felt like I understood Alex in the slightest. There was an opportunity to create a really rich, intriguing character - but instead, we’re given more of a shell. I had a similar issue with Emma Cline’s first novel, The Girls. The ideas are all there, the writing is really nice, but there’s a lack in terms of characterization that just doesn’t work for me. Emphasizing for me! I don’t think this is a bad book at all, just not one that worked for my particular reading needs.

I am grateful to the publisher for the eARC, and I like Cline’s writing style enough to probably continue reading her books in the future.
